use 5.008;
use warnings;
use strict;

package Class::Scaffold::Exception::Container;
our $VERSION = '1.100760';

# ABSTRACT: Implements a container object for exceptions

# It's ok to inherit from Class::Scaffold::Storable as well; new() will be
# found in Error::Hierarchy first. For the exception class itself, to inherit
# from Class::Scaffold::Base would be enough, but there might be subclasses
# that need the 'storage' accessor - Class::Scaffold::Exception::Container, for
# example.
use parent qw(
  Error::Hierarchy::Container
  Class::Scaffold::Storable
);
1;
